• 数据库 续


         聚合函数:

    count:统计行数量

    sun   :获取某个单列合计值

    avg    :计算某个列的平均值

    max,min:计算列的最大值和最小值

    *  :计算全部,包含null值

    all:计算所有非空值

    distinct:计算所有唯一非空值(去重复)

          子查询:嵌套在查询语句里面的查询语句

    exsits:当子查询能查出来值    才会执行

    no exsits:如果子查询没有查出来值 ,就不执行。(整条语句忽略)

        表连接:

    内连接:inner join , 效率最低的连接方式

    外连接:left join :以左边为基

                right join:以右边为基

    自连接:full join,MySQL 不支持(不理会)

    JDBC:

    应用程序--JDBCAPI--JDBC驱动程序,管理器--JDBC驱动程序--网络协议(API)--数据库服务器

    JDBC_ODBC Bridge:JDBC_ODBC桥

    由sun公司提供的通道的驱动,能访问各种数据库,但是效率很低

    Native_API Partly_java driver:本地java驱动程序

          执行效率高,但客户端必须安装本地驱动,维护不方便

    Net_protocal all_java driver(JDBC Proxy):网络协议纯java驱动程序(通用的)

        客户端不必安装本地库,使用方便但是性能相对较低

     Native_Protocal all_java driver:本地协议,完全java驱动程序

        将JDBC调用转化为特定数据库的网络协议,效率很高

    执行顺序:select * from(表名)where(条件)from(表名)——》where(条件)——》group by——》

    select(  )——》having

  • 相关阅读:
    go语言-值类型与引用类型
    MongoDB小东西
    2018年12月29日
    父进程结束,其子进程不会结束,会挂到init进程下
    python处理Windows平台上路径有空格
    python print 在windows上 出现 Bad file descriptor error
    docker私有镜像仓库搭建
    docker 在centos6 和centos7上的区别
    virtualbox 设置centos7 双网卡上网
    Centos6.6安装docker
  • 原文地址:https://www.cnblogs.com/haoziwoaini/p/5494857.html
Copyright © 2020-2023  润新知